GWT: как я могу переименовать мой модуль - PullRequest
4 голосов
/ 27 февраля 2012

Я хочу переименовать имя моего модуля ниже от тестирования к тестированию, но когда я изменяю его с рефакторинга на тестирование, он говорит:

           unable to find test.gwt.xml

все еще ищет предыдущее имя модуля ..

как я могу решить эту проблему

спасибо9 +

               <?xml version="1.0" encoding="UTF-8"?>
               <module rename-to='test'>

              <!-- Inherit the core Web Toolkit stuff.                        -->
               <inherits name='com.google.gwt.user.User'/>

Ответы [ 3 ]

5 голосов
/ 07 марта 2012

Вы можете обратиться к следующему видео.

http://www.youtube.com/watch?v=UW4WSYs1bKE

Переименовать

  1. Щелкните правой кнопкой мыши по проекту.
  2. Выберите Run As ---> Run Configurations.
  3. На вкладке «Аргументы» измените имена старых модулей в аргументах программы.
  4. Также убедитесь, что во вкладке GWT выбранное имя модуля является правильным.

UPDATE

Данное видео сейчас недоступно на YouTube. Может быть удалено владельцем.

4 голосов
/ 27 февраля 2012

Здесь есть несколько шагов.Модуль управляется файлом modulename.gwt.xml.Сначала переименуйте этот файл.Я не уверен, но я думаю, что вам также нужно изменить имя пакета пути Java на новое имя.Затем отредактируйте файл gwt.xml и измените точку входа и строки «переименовать».Если модуль является первым модулем, который запускается при запуске вашего приложения, вам нужно изменить настройки запуска проекта, чтобы узнать новую точку входа.Это очень важно, я надеюсь, что у меня есть все места.

2 голосов
/ 28 февраля 2012

Проблема, с которой вы, скорее всего, сталкиваетесь, заключается в том, что вы не изменили конфигурацию запуска в eclipse. Пока имя пакета не изменено, нет необходимости редактировать файл .gwt.xml, кроме как переименовывать его. Изменение имен модулей переименования и точки входа не требуется, поскольку необязательно, чтобы они совпадали с именем модуля. Строка rename-to изменяет имя создаваемой папки и javascript-файлов, поэтому, если вы ее измените, не забудьте поменять тег script в html-файле.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...